Motorola ColdFire MCF5281 User Manual page 97

Motorola microcontroller user's manual
Table of Contents

Advertisement

Table 2-14. Two Operand Instruction Execution Times (continued)
Opcode
<EA>
and.l
<ea>,Rx
and.l
Dy,<ea>
andi.l
#imm,Dx
asl.l
<ea>,Dx
asr.l
<ea>,Dx
bchg
Dy,<ea>
bchg
#imm,<ea>
bclr
Dy,<ea>
bclr
#imm,<ea>
bset
Dy,<ea>
bset
#imm,<ea>
btst
Dy,<ea>
btst
#imm,<ea>
cmp.l
<ea>,Rx
cmpi.l
#imm,Dx
1
divs.w
<ea>,Dx
1
divu.w
<ea>,Dx
1
divs.l
<ea>,Dx
1
divu.l
<ea>,Dx
eor.l
Dy,<ea>
eori.l
#imm,Dx
lea
<ea>,Ax
lsl.l
<ea>,Dx
lsr.l
<ea>,Dx
moveq
#imm,Dx
muls.w
<ea>y, Dx
mulu.w
<ea>y, Dx
muls.l
<ea>y, Dx
mulu.l
<ea>y, Dx
or.l
<ea>,Rx
or.l
Dy,<ea>
ori.l
#imm,Dx
1
rems.l
<ea>,Dx
1
remu.l
<ea>,Dx
sub.l
<ea>,Rx
sub.l
Dy,<ea>
MOTOROLA
Rn
(An)
(An)+
1(0/0)
3(1/0)
3(1/0)
3(1/1)
3(1/1)
1(0/0)
1(0/0)
1(0/0)
2(0/0)
4(1/1)
4(1/1)
2(0/0)
4(1/1)
4(1/1)
2(0/0)
4(1/1)
4(1/1)
2(0/0)
4(1/1)
4(1/1)
2(0/0)
4(1/1)
41/1)
2(0/0)
4(1/1)
4(1/1)
2(0/0)
3(1/1)
3(1/1)
1(0/0)
3(1/1)
3(1/1)
1(0/0)
3(1/0)
3(1/0)
1(0/0)
20(0/0)
23(1/0)
23(1/0)
20(0/0)
23(1/0)
23(1/0)
≤35(0/0) ≤38(1/0) ≤38(1/0) ≤38(1/0) ≤38(1/0)
≤35(0/0) ≤38(1/0) ≤38(1/0) ≤38(1/0) ≤38(1/0)
1(0/0)
3(1/1)
3(1/1)
1(0/0)
1(0/0)
1(0/0)
1(0/0)
4(0/0)
6(1/0)
6(1/0)
4(0/0)
6(1/0)
6(1/0)
4(0/0)
6(1/0)
6(1/0)
4(0/0)
6(1/0)
6(1/0)
1(0/0)
3(1/0)
3(1/0)
3(1/1)
3(1/1)
1(0/0)
≤35(0/0) ≤38(1/0) ≤38(1/0) ≤38(1/0) ≤38(1/0)
≤35(0/0) ≤38(1/0) ≤38(1/0) ≤38(1/0) ≤38(1/0)
1(0/0)
3(1/0)
3(1/0)
3(1/1)
3(1/1)
Chapter 2. ColdFire Core
Standard Two Operand Instruction Execution Times
Effective Address
(d16,An)
(d8,An,Xn*SF)
-(An)
(d16,PC)
(d8,PC,Xn*SF)
3(1/0)
3(1/0)
4(1/0)
3(1/1)
3(1/1)
4(1/1)
4(1/1)
4(1/1)
5(1/1)
4(1/1)
4(1/1)
4(1/1)
4(1/1)
5(1/1)
4(1/1)
4(1/1)
4(1/1)
4(1/1)
5(1/1)
4(1/1)
4(1/1)
3(1/1)
3(1/1)
4(1/1)
3(1/1)
3(1/1)
3(1/0)
3(1/0)
4(1/0)
23(1/0)
23(1/0)
24(1/0)
23(1/0)
23(1/0)
24(1/0)
3(1/1)
3(1/1)
4(1/1)
1(0/0)
2(0/0)
6(1/0)
6(1/0)
7(1/0)
6(1/0)
6(1/0)
7(1/0)
6(1/0)
6(1/0)
6(1/0)
6(1/0)
3(1/0)
3(1/0)
4(1/0)
3(1/1)
3(1/1)
4(1/1)
3(1/0)
3(1/0)
4(1/0)
3(1/1)
3(1/1)
4(1/1)
xxx.wl
#xxx
3(1/0)
1(0/0)
3(1/1)
1(0/0)
1(0/0)
4(1/1)
4(1/1)
4(1/1)
3(1/1)
1(0/0)
3(1/0)
1(0/0)
23(1/0)
20(0/0)
23(1/0)
20(0/0)
3(1/1)
1(0/0)
1(0/0)
1(0/0)
1(0/0)
6(1/0)
4(1/0)
6(1/0)
4(1/0)
3(1/0)
1(0/0)
3(1/1)
3(1/0)
1(0/0)
3(1/1)
2-25

Advertisement

Table of Contents
loading

This manual is also suitable for:

Coldfire mcf5282

Table of Contents